(Triticum monococcum); aka Farro piccolo; Hulled; Winter
An ancient European grain, Einkorn means "one kernel" in German and references the fact that there is just one grain per hull. A culinary staple in Italy, the grain is one of the farros, specifically farro piccolo, due to its small size.
These seeds are still within their hulls.
